How We Work
1
Emergency Call & Assessment
Your urgent call to Allentown Cleanup Team initiates immediate dispatch. We arrive with moisture meters to assess the damage scope, identifying affected areas and potential hazards. This critical information guides our rapid response.
2
Water Extraction
Using powerful truck-mounted extraction units, we swiftly remove standing water from your property. This prevents further saturation and prepares the area for specialized drying equipment. Speed is essential to minimize secondary damage.
3
Drying & Dehumidification
High-capacity air movers and commercial dehumidifiers are strategically placed to thoroughly dry all affected materials. We monitor moisture levels daily to ensure complete drying. This prevents mold growth and structural issues.
4
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Once dry, we clean and sanitize all salvageable surfaces using EPA-approved antimicrobial agents. Our HEPA vacuums remove contaminants. This ensures a safe, healthy environment, ready for restoration work.
5
Restoration & Follow-Up
Our team repairs or replaces damaged structural elements, returning your property to its pre-loss condition. We conduct a final walk-through with you, ensuring your complete satisfaction. Your property is fully restored.

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No DIY is fine for small water leaks,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Standing water in a basement can hide hidden dangers, such as structural damage and mold growth, so it's best to call a pro for safe and effective removal.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Wet drywall can hide hidden water damage and mold growth, so it's best to call a pro for safe and effective removal and replacement.
Small water leak under sink Yes No DIY is fine for small water leaks,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age and call a pro if you're not comfortable with DIY repairs.
Flooded crawlspace with standing water No Yes Standing water in a crawlspace can hide hidden dangers, such as structural damage and mold growth, so it's best to call a pro for safe and effective removal.
Water damage to hardwood floors No Yes Water damage to hardwood floors can be difficult to repair and need specialized equipment, so it's best to call a pro for safe and effective restoration.

With emergency damage restoration, don't take any chances, call a pro for safe and effective removal and restoration of your property.

Emergency Damage Restoration Cost in the 17601 Area

The cost of emergency damage restoration in the 17601 area can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will work with you to provide a customized estimate and help you navigate the complex process of insurance claims and reimbursement.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Structural Drying Process $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age.
Sewage Cleanup $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age.
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Mold Remediation $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age.
